Population Overview
Lockhart city is a small city located in Texas. The total population is 14,708. It ranks as the 210th most populous out of 1,800 cities and towns in Texas.
Age Demographics
The median age in Lockhart city is 37.7 years. This is 6% higher than the state median of 35.5 years.
Economy, Income & Housing
The median household income in Lockhart city is $67,252. This is 12% lower than the state median of $76,292. Compared to the national median of $78,538, household income here is 14% lower. The poverty rate stands at 13.1%. This is 5% lower than the state poverty rate of 13.8%. The unemployment rate is 1.5%. This is 70% lower than the state rate of 5.1%. The median home value is $218,400. Housing costs are 16% lower than the state median of $260,400. The home-value-to-income ratio is 3.2x. 63.2% of occupied housing units are owner-occupied.
Race & Ethnicity
The largest racial or ethnic group in Lockhart city is Hispanic or Latino, making up 52.9% of the population. White (non-Hispanic) residents account for 37.3%. The Black or African American population (4.6%) is well below the state average of 11.9%. The Asian population (1.0%) is well below the state average of 5.3%.
Education
16.7% of residents aged 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her. This is 49% lower than the state rate of 33.1%. Nationally, 35.0% of adults hold at least a bachelor's degree. The high school graduation rate (or equivalent) is 87.1%.
Data Sources & Methodology
All demographic data for Lockhart city, Texas is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ates (2019-2023). The ACS collects data from approximately 3.5 million households annually, providing reliable estimates for communities of all sizes. Comparisons are made against Texas state averages and national averages calculated from the same dataset. Rankings reflect the city's position among all 1,800 Census-designated places in Texas.
